Brittania-U Assures Fire Incident At FPSO Facility Under Control

An indigenous integrated energy company, Brittania-U Nigeria Limited, has declared that the fire incident which occurred on Thursday, July 18, 2024, at its Floating Production Storage and Offloading Facility (FPSO) situated at the former OML 90 field, now PML 6, offshore Ogulagha Kingdom offshore Warri, is now under control.

Advertisement

Disclosing this in a statement signed by the Chairman and Chief Executive Officer, Uju Ifejika, the company stated that a thorough investigation has commenced to determine the cause of the fire incident and that it will share further updates with the public as soon as possible.

According to the statement, “Brittania -U wishes to update the general public that the fire incident which occurred on Thursday, July 18, 2024, at its Floating Production Storage and Offloading Facility (FPSO) situated at the former OML 90 field, now PML 6, offshore Ogulagha Kingdom offshore Warri, is now under control.

“The Company has commenced a thorough investigation to determine the cause of the fire incident and will share further updates with the public as soon as possible.

“Brittania -U Management wishes to express its sincere appreciation to Shell, the Nigerian Navy, NUPRC, NNPCL, NIMASA, and all well-meaning Nigerians who showed support during the fire outbreak.”
